Landlab studio associato was born in 1983. Originally called "Agronomi Associati", the two main areas of intervention were parks and gardens and territory planning. In the early ‘90's, Agronomi Associati carried out a great deal of research and development activities on turfs, run on a first sample field in partnership with the University of Padova, Faculty of Agricultural Science.
Soon after, it became a point of reference on turf research for seed industry. Throughout the years, Agronomi Associati has increased and strengthened relations and partnerships with companies and local authorities.
Agronomi Associati became Landlab studio associato in 2005.
